软件行业作为信息技术的核心领域,其发展速度之快、影响范围之广,使得风险分析变得尤为重要。识别与管理关键挑战是确保软件项目成功的关键步骤。以下是对软件行业风险分析的详细探讨:
一、技术风险
1. 技术过时:随着科技的快速发展,新技术不断涌现。如果软件公司未能及时跟进或升级现有技术,可能会导致产品功能落后,无法满足市场需求。
2. 技术实施难度:新技术的实施往往伴随着较高的成本和复杂性。如果软件公司在实施过程中遇到技术难题,可能会延误项目进度,甚至导致项目失败。
3. 技术兼容性问题:在软件开发过程中,需要与其他系统或平台进行集成。如果软件公司未能充分考虑到技术兼容性问题,可能会导致系统之间的数据交换出现问题,影响整体性能。
二、市场风险
1. 市场需求变化:市场环境的变化可能导致软件产品的市场需求发生变化。如果软件公司未能及时调整产品策略,可能会失去市场份额。
2. 竞争对手压力:在竞争激烈的软件市场中,竞争对手的策略和行动可能对软件公司的业务产生重大影响。如果软件公司未能有效应对竞争压力,可能会面临市场份额下滑的风险。
3. 法规政策变动:政府政策和法规的变化可能对软件行业产生重大影响。例如,数据保护法规的加强可能导致软件公司需要投入更多资源来遵守新规定,从而增加运营成本。
三、财务风险
1. 资金链断裂:软件项目通常需要大量资金投入,如果软件公司未能获得足够的融资或现金流出现问题,可能会导致项目延期或失败。
2. 成本超支:在软件开发过程中,可能会出现预算超支的情况。如果软件公司未能及时发现并控制成本,可能会导致财务状况恶化。
3. 投资回报率低:软件项目的投资回报周期较长,如果软件公司未能实现预期的投资回报率,可能会影响投资者的信心和公司的声誉。
四、法律与合规风险
1. 知识产权侵权:在软件开发过程中,可能会涉及到知识产权的问题。如果软件公司未能妥善处理知识产权问题,可能会面临法律诉讼或赔偿风险。
2. 数据安全与隐私保护:随着数据泄露事件的频发,数据安全和隐私保护成为软件公司必须重视的问题。如果软件公司未能采取有效的安全措施,可能会导致用户信任度下降和法律责任。
3. 合同违约:在软件开发过程中,可能会涉及到与其他合作伙伴或客户的合同关系。如果软件公司未能履行合同义务,可能会面临合同违约的风险。
五、人力资源风险
1. 人才流失:软件行业竞争激烈,优秀人才的流动可能导致技术断层和知识传承问题。如果软件公司未能吸引和留住关键人才,可能会影响项目的质量和创新能力。
2. 团队协作障碍:在软件开发过程中,团队成员之间的沟通和协作至关重要。如果软件公司未能建立有效的团队文化和管理机制,可能会导致工作效率低下和团队凝聚力下降。
3. 员工培训与发展:为了保持竞争力,软件公司需要为员工提供持续的培训和发展机会。如果软件公司未能关注员工的个人成长和职业规划,可能会影响员工的工作积极性和忠诚度。
六、供应链风险
1. 供应商不稳定:在软件开发过程中,供应链的稳定性对于项目的成功至关重要。如果软件公司未能选择可靠的供应商或管理好供应商关系,可能会导致原材料短缺、交付延迟等问题。
2. 物流成本增加:由于全球贸易环境的变化和运输成本的波动,物流成本可能会对软件公司的财务状况产生影响。如果软件公司未能有效控制物流成本,可能会导致项目成本增加和利润下降。
3. 产品质量问题:供应链中的质量问题可能导致软件产品存在缺陷或不符合标准要求。如果软件公司未能及时发现并解决这些问题,可能会影响产品的市场竞争力和客户满意度。
综上所述,软件行业面临的风险多种多样,从技术、市场、财务、法律到人力资源和供应链等方面都可能存在潜在风险。因此,软件公司需要进行全面的风险评估和管理,制定相应的风险应对策略,以确保项目的顺利进行和长期发展。